Local residents may ascertain which axe the fcaina which •ater for thair towns, and may then work ost tha time wMeh the train, irili take to travel from tha atation ' a mediately preoeding. IMPORTANT TO TRAVELLERS, irom Ist Deoember an express train stops at Levin daily at 11.20 p.m. to take up passengers, but thoee who go orth by this train will have to pay th« full fare from Well 4 ngton to whatever place north of Levin thai tho .« prtod stops at. , At 4.10 a.m., daily, the express ill op at Levin to pick up jMusengara but as no ticket* are issued for either of these trains at Levm, pasaengent must pay the guards. Passengers cy this early morning train gain* «oath will have to pay the full fare from Palmertaon North to Wellington. ■
